Transaction 72ef13b95352de93e0d4e3ec4b0b7fb911dfd1326b7be8d4bb14ba7148eb23d2
1 Input
1 Output
-
72ef13b95352de93e0d4e3ec4b0b7fb911dfd1326b7be8d4bb14ba7148eb23d2:0
- value
- 49042098
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d7a429c28d7f3edb0e71d252177b1f22e27c55bf OP_EQUAL
- address
- 3MMDs3LmfRR9W3Ks3Yto8xhpuAXrQp3GQA